Here's a simple and delicious meal you can make even if you're not sure what to cook, along with some tips for making it your own:
One-Pan Roasted Chicken & Veggies
Ingredients:
* 1 whole chicken (about 3-4 pounds), cut into 8 pieces (optional)
* 1 tablespoon olive oil
* 1 teaspoon salt
* 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
* 1 large onion, cut into wedges
* 2-3 carrots, cut into 1-inch chunks
* 1-2 potatoes, cut into 1-inch chunks
* 1 cup broccoli florets
Instructions:
1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
2. Prep the chicken: Rinse the chicken pieces and pat them dry. If you're using a whole chicken, cut it into 8 pieces.
3. Season the chicken: Rub the olive oil, salt, and pepper all over the chicken pieces.
4. Assemble the pan: Place the chicken, onions, carrots, potatoes, and broccoli in a large roasting pan.
5. Roast: Bake for 45-55 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through and the vegetables are tender. The internal temperature of the chicken should reach 165°F (74°C).
6. Serve: Let the chicken rest for 5-10 minutes before serving.
Tips for Making it Your Own:
* Spice it up: Add a pinch of garlic powder, paprika, or other spices to the chicken rub.
* Change the veggies: Use any vegetables you have on hand, such as zucchini, bell peppers, or asparagus.
* Add flavor: Drizzle a little lemon juice over the vegetables before roasting.
* Make it a meal: Serve with a side of rice or couscous.
Why This Recipe is Great for Beginners:
* Simple Ingredients: You likely have most of the ingredients in your pantry or fridge.
* One-Pan Easy: It's minimal cleanup!
* Flavorful: The roasting process brings out delicious flavors in the chicken and vegetables.
* Versatile: You can customize it to your liking.
